This 1972 image depicted a close view of the great toes of a patient, who had presented with dry, crusty lesions of the feet, involving primarily the toes, and was diagnosed as a case of tinea pedis, but more precisely, tinea unguium, or a fungal infection of the toenails, due to an undisclosed dermatophytic fungal organism.
